Commercial Description:
A Czech style Pilsner, using Gabrinus Organic Pilsner Malt, Weyermann Organic Carahell and Weyerman Acidulated Malts. The hop bill is a bittering addition (Zeus), aroma addition (Saaz), and whole flower Saaz in the hop back.

Draft at the brewery. Clear yellow with a white head. Fruity hop nose of melon and lemon citrus. Wet on the palate, medium bodied, some light coarseness in the back, and some plastic grain twang in there as well. Okay but nothing like true Czech pils.
